Can houseplants improve my mood? Author David Domoney thinks so as he draws on recent scientific research in his book, My House Plant Changed My Life: Green Well-being for the Great Indoors. In it, he covers 50 houseplants and how they may improve mental well-being through their color, scent, habit, and nurturing needs.
